CLASS DESCRIPTIONS:
INTRODUCTION TO ACTING LEVEL I (Age 6-9)
Time: 8:30-9:30AM
Learn basic acting techniques, tips and terms. This fun format
introduces students to stage direction, theater etiquette,
character analysis, scene work and more.

INTRODUCTION TO ACTING LEVEL II (Age 10-14)
Time: 9:45-10:45AM
Advanced version of Level I: Learn basic acting techniques,
tips and terms. This fun format introduces students to stage
direction, theater etiquette, character analysis, scene work and more.

INTERMEDIATE ACTING (Age 11-16)
Time: 11:00-Noon
Review basic acting techniques then move on to in-depth
character analysis, monologues, scene work, voice/dialect work,
and introduction of various styles of acting.

All classes will be taught by
Doug Fordyce, owner/director of Kids On Stage.
